There are a lot of reports that walkers are not safe for children and that they should be banned etc because they can move around. If you are looking for ways to have her upright and able to play etc there are a couple of safer options - one is a product by Safety First (I think) that is like a walker but without the wheels - an activity table that has a seat in the middle so they can reach things etc and turn around, but not "walk" - Target had them on sale in the last week or so.
The other option is the good old jolly jumper - hang it from a door frame and let the fun begin. I found mine very useful for doing the vacuuming:o - they are up and watching but not on the floor in the way!
